Public bug reported: Binary package hint: phpmyadmin
If I install phpmyadmin and want to use the "extended functionality" (pma-user, bookmarks etc.), it shows the server-version as "3.23.32" and consequently complains about the client-library-version and the server- version to be out of sync. This is described here: http://sourceforge.net/tracker/index.php?func=detail&aid=1875010&group_id=23067&atid=377408 This should be fixed.
